The bites of mosquitoes, horseflies, fleas, and those types of bites, have typically been treated with temporary solutions.

The stings of bees, wasps, jellyfish, and imported red fire ants have been typically soaked with concoctions that only numbed or blocked the pain with chemicals such as ammonia.

The majority of products contain cortisone, menthol, Benzocaine or camphor; they only address the itching. Others contain Antihistamines, which cause drowsiness, and should not be used while operating any type of machinery.

Most require repeated applications and could be dangerous if used or swallowed by children.
